My tip for a good sleep is:
"Tone Float" by Organisation
it is the first album released by Ralf H?tter and Florian Schneider before they made Kraftwerk. This album is very underrated, mostly 2/10, but I think it is a pretty good album, although it is VERY experimental, but if you like "Ummagumma", you will like this too.

There are three cd's that are certain to make me sleep. Raymond Scott's Soothing Sounds For Babies vol. 1-3. Vols 1 & 2 are about 30 min long, but it took me quite a few listens before I could hear them all the way through.
